The Department of Anesthesia and Perioperative Care is seeking a Director of Trauma and Acute Care Anesthesia (DTACA) at Zuckerberg San Francisco General Hospital (ZSFG). Reporting to the ZSFG Associate Chief of Clinical Operations, the DTACA is responsible for all trauma care relevant efforts, including but not limited to strategy, planning, clinical care, operations, quality & performance improvement, education, and research in order to maintain and expand the state-of-the-art trauma and acute care anesthesia operation for ZSFG. Equally, the DTACA is tasked to ensure a national reputation and produce a visible and active engagement furthering the subspecialty of Trauma and Acute Care Anesthesia. The DTACA is asked to coordinate and initiate trauma and acute care centric research within the Department, as well as building and expanding collaborations with other departments. The DTACA also serves as a liaison to both the Department of Surgery, the Critical Care Units and the Emergency Department maintaining a collaborative, collegial, and productive partnership. Additionally, the DTACA oversees the Trauma Anesthesia and Acute Care Fellowship Program at ZSFG.
The Director of Trauma and Acute Care Anesthesia is responsible for:
- Oversight of all aspects of anesthesia related clinical care and operations for acute care and trauma patients
- Developing and deploying the strategy for all the Department’s efforts relevant to trauma and acute care.
- Partnering with Trauma Surgery and Emergency Medicine to optimize collaboration and collegiality for seamless trauma care.
- Collaborating with other services including Emergency Medicine on patient safety initiatives and quality improvement efforts.
- Working with trauma related surgical specialties to optimize perioperative management of injured patients, including general surgery, orthopedics, and neurosurgery.
- Research efforts as they pertain to the care of the injured. This includes but is not limited to: coordination of all trauma-related research projects, collaboration with anesthesia leadership to strategize research efforts in trauma and acute care anesthesia, mentor junior researchers and fellows for trauma-related research projects, interact with other departments actively involved in trauma-related research (Surgery, Emergency Medicine, SICU, Neuroscience ICU).
- Maintaining the Trauma Anesthesia and Acute Care Fellowship at UCSF/ZSFG. This includes, but is not limited to: recruitment, selection, mentorship, education, and advocation of the Fellows. The DTACA will work with the ZSFG Associate Chief of Education & the Anesthesia Education Committee at ZSFG to provide an intense, structured, and valuable fellowship.
- Quality and Performance Improvement efforts within the trauma and acute care domain. The DTACA will work in collaboration with anesthesia QI leadership to identify, follow and analyze trauma-specific metrics. The DTACA will coordinate quality improvement clinical projects.

The successful candidate must meet the following qualifications by time of hire:
- Must hold an MD, DO, or equivalent degree and be board eligible or certified in Anesthesia.
- Must possess a valid California Medical License
- Must be fellowship trained or have equivalent advanced training and/or experience beyond that of anesthesia residency training.
